“Ho Ho Ho Merry Christmas little boy! What’s your name?” Santa Clause asked.
“Bobby.”
“Hello Bobby, what would you like for Christmas?”
“Mr. Santa Clause Sir, I would like a family that will love and care for me with all their heart.”
“Well Bobby I can try my best! But families are the hardest wish to make come true.”
“Oh please Sir!’
Santa winks as he says, “Elf! Please take Bobby to his nanny.”


Bobby was a little ten year old boy whose parents died in a terrible car accident when he was only two years old. As a result, he has very little memory of his parents. Bobby lives in an orphanage with twelve other boys and girls. Every year the nannies that take care of all the children do their best to give each of them their Christmas wish.


Two weeks were left until Christmas Day. Everybody was so excited to see if their wish would actually come true. Throughout the days leading up to the big day, many couples would come to look at the children. Being one of the older children in the orphanage, Bobby was always making sure he looked his best for the couples. Most of the other children wouldn’t notice if they were being observed because they weren’t old enough to know what was happening. Most of the couples that came in didn’t seem very serious in adopting until one day.


On December 23, a polite couple came in looking to adopt. They wanted a sweet young boy that was mannered, kind, and caring. Bobby over heard their expectations and showed them all his skills and manners. He for sure thought they were interested in him until another boy in the orphanage came into the room. Within a matter of seconds, Bobby thought they were falling for him. Unfortunately, they weren’t able to make up their mind so they told the nannies they would be back tomorrow. The next day rolled around and no sign of the happy couple. Bobby was so worried that they either wouldn’t come back or they would choose the other boy over him.

Christmas Eve was a nightmare for everyone. Couples flew in and flew out faster than you could say a simple “Hello”. The orphanage was so crowded several of the kids would hide so they weren’t squished. Within a matter of hours a majority of the children had been adopted except for Bobby. Bobby had no idea that the happy couple that had come in a couple days before had put him on their waiting list. They were waiting till Christmas Day to surprise him with adoption.

Christmas Day was finally here. All the orphans that were left ran out of their beds to see what Santa had brought them. Once they saw the Christmas tree, they found couples with signs in their hands saying the name of their child that they were adopting.
“Hi Bobby! I’m Nancy and this is George. We’re here to adopt you!” Before Bobby could even take a look around, he ran and gave the couple the biggest bear hug known to man.
“Come on son, let’s take you home!”
